How much does an SQL Analyst make in Madison, WI?
As of March 01, 2025, the average annual salary for an SQL Analyst in Madison, WI is $103,133. Salary.com reports that pay typically ranges from $89,854 to $117,219, with most professionals earning between $77,764 and $130,044.
About Madison, Wisconsin
Madison is located in the center of Dane County in south-central Wisconsin, 77 miles (124 km) west of Milwaukee and 122 miles (196 km) northwest of Chicago. The city completely surrounds the smaller Town of Madison, the City of Monona, and the villages of Maple Bluff and Shorewood Hills. Madison shares borders with its largest suburb, Sun Prairie, and three other suburbs, Middleton, McFarland, and Fitchburg. Other suburbs include the city of Verona and the villages of Cottage Grove, DeForest, and Waunakee as well as Mount Horeb, Oregon, Stoughton, and Cross Plains among others.

These charts show the average base salary (core compensation), as well as the average total cash compensation for the job of SQL Analyst in Madison, WI. The base salary for SQL Analyst ranges from $89,854 to $117,219 with the average base salary of $103,133. The total cash compensation, which includes base, and annual incentives, can vary anywhere from $92,971 to $124,860 with the average total cash compensation of $108,128.
